Octopath Traveler 0: A New Chapter in HD‑2D RPGs
Introduction
Square Enix has expanded its HD‑2D portfolio with the release of Octopath Traveler 0 in December 2025. This new installment builds on the foundation of the original Octopath Traveler while introducing innovative mechanics, including character creation, a unified storyline, and expanded party systems. For many players, the game evokes nostalgia for classic titles like Final Fantasy while offering modern refinements that set it apart in today’s RPG landscape (Wen, 2025).
Visual Style
The hallmark of Octopath Traveler 0 is its 2.5D HD‑2D art style, which blends pixelated characters with dynamic lighting and modern effects. This aesthetic has become a signature of Square Enix’s retro-inspired RPGs, also seen in Triangle Strategy and the upcoming Dragon Quest III HD‑2D Remake. The style is both unique and immersive, creating a visual experience that feels simultaneously nostalgic and contemporary (Newnham, 2025).
Character Creation and Freedom
Unlike previous entries, Octopath Traveler 0 allows players to create their own protagonist. During character creation, players select a skill, favorite foods, and starting items, which personalize the journey. This system reinforces the theme of “be anyone, go anywhere,” offering freedom and replayability. Beyond the protagonist, the game features over 30 recruitable companions, each with distinct abilities and storylines (Watts, 2025).
Story and Themes
The narrative in Octopath Traveler 0 is more cohesive than its predecessors. Instead of eight separate tales, the story follows the custom hero through arcs centered on the corrupting influences of Wealth, Power, and Fame. The darker tone explores betrayal, greed, and resilience, while maintaining emotional resonance. Notably, the game is fully voiced, which enhances immersion and character depth (Hector, 2025).
Gameplay and Combat
Combat remains turn-based, retaining the familiar Boost Point and Break systems. However, a major innovation is the ability to field eight characters at once, four in the front row and four in the back, with strategic swapping during battles. This mechanic adds tactical depth and variety, making encounters more challenging and rewarding. The system balances accessibility for newcomers with complexity for veterans (Watts, 2025).
Demo and Accessibility
Square Enix released a demo in November 2025, allowing players to experience the first three hours of gameplay. Progress from the demo can be carried over to the full game, making it a practical way to test mechanics and story before purchase. This approach lowers the barrier to entry and encourages exploration of the game’s unique systems (Square Enix, 2025).
Conclusion
Octopath Traveler 0 represents both a continuation and an evolution of the franchise. With its HD‑2D style, character creation, fully voiced narrative, and expanded combat system, it captures the spirit of classic JRPGs while offering innovations that appeal to modern audiences. For players who grew up with Final Fantasy and similar titles, this game feels like a bridge between past and present. The demo ensures accessibility, while the full release promises a rich, challenging, and memorable journey.
